Usage of earbuds
You can connect earbuds / recording terminals to
your earbuds or headsets to listen to music in stereo.
Earbuds or headsets are not supplied.
Please use your own one.
Turn the power switch & volume dial anti-
clockwise and set the volume to the minimum.
Connect the earbud terminal to
Φ
3.5mm stereo
mini plug earbud or headset cable.
Earbuds &
recording
terminal
After connecting earbuds or headset cable,
sound does not come out of the speaker.
Play the record.
Turn the power switch & volume dial to adjust to
easy-to-listen sound volume.
When using earbuds, increase sound
volume incrementally not to damage
your ears with loud noise.

How to record
You can record the record’s sound by connecting
a recording device with external input terminal like
radio cassette recorder to earbuds & recording
terminal.
Preparation
Recording
Connection cord for recording is not
supplied. Please use your own ones.
Prepare the cord with has
Φ
3.5mm stereo mini
plug at one end and a terminal to connect to input
terminal of recording device at another end.
Connect
Φ
3.5mm stereo mini plug of connection
cord to earbud terminal and another plug to the
recording device.
